Markets & Fairs

Ringwood’s Charter Market runs every Wednesday in the Market Place and the Town Council supported it’s relaunch in 2018. For further information go to its Facebook page.

Other regular markets held in Gateway Square include:

Antique & Decorative Arts Market (bi-monthly)

Events for 2026 - 11th April, 6th June, 1st August, 10th October and 14th November

Ringwood Farmers' Market (monthly) 

Events for 2026 - 31st January, 28th February, 28th March, 25th April, 30th May, 27th June, 25th July, 29th August, 26th September, 31st October, 28th November and 19th December.

Artisan Market (monthly)

Events for 2026 - 21st March, 18th April, 16th May, 20th June, 18th July, 15th August, 12th September, 17th October, 21st November and 12th December

 

Please check if there are any last minute changes due to weather conditions.

Gorley Road Bus Stop Upgraded with New Shelter

A new, larger bus shelter has been installed on Gorley Road, funded by New Forest District Council’s CIL Local Infrastructure Fund, to provide better comfort, seating, and accessibility for local bus users.

Strong Community Spirit Highlighted at Ringwood Annual Town Assembly

More than 100 residents attended Ringwood’s Annual Town Assembly, where the Mayor presented the Council’s Annual Report alongside updates, community discussions and a celebration of the town’s 800-year heritage. The evening also saw Greyfriars Community Minibus Service and Ringwood Good Neighbours recognised with a Community Award for their outstanding support to local residents.
